To promote open communication and transparency, we welcome comments on platforms including our Faceb

ook, Twitter and Instagram pages. However, we also aim to promote safety and constructive communication for all who participate in our online communities. With this in mind, comments that include the following content (and others deemed inappropriate) may be deleted:

-Inappropriate language, including but not limited to vulgarity, profanity, or hate speech (which may include comments that target a person’s race, ethnicity, sexuality, gender identity, religious preference, etc.)
-Threats against John McCandless students or staff members
-Spamming or promotional material that is unrelated to the topic at hand
-Statements that reveal personal information about John McCandless students or staff members without their consent
-Libelous statements that may unfairly harm a person’s reputation, including but not limited to allegations of criminal activity

We reserve the right to monitor and moderate comments made on our social media platforms on a case by case basis. Comments that are deemed a violation of our guidelines may be removed with or without notification. We also reserve the right to block or remove social media access for users who repeatedly violate these guidelines, which may be modified based on new developments or our personal discretion.

Project Based Learning (PBL) gives John McCandless students many exciting opportunities to discover the ways science impacts the environments and communities that surround us. Last week, 3rd Graders started their first PBL unit with a walking field trip to the Calaveras River. Students wrote down what they noticed about their local waterways, and they'll use these notes to continue studying biodiversity and ecosystems.

Our 3rd Graders are investigating the John McCandless mascot: owls! Mrs. Marriott's and Mr. Manzo's classes have already learned how owls digest their food and why small animals in their environment are disappearing. Today, 3rd Graders dissected owl pellets to look for bones and other remnants of the animals owls eat to survive.
